Abstract

Women's empowerment is a process of awareness and capacity building for greater participation, greater power and oversight of decision-making and transformational action in order to produce greater equality between women and men. Empowerment of women is an important strategy in increasing the role of women in increasing their potential so that they are more capable of being independent and working. Reproductive health is a state of complete physical, mental and social well-being, which is not merely free from disease or disability, in all matters relating to the reproductive system, as well as its functions and processes. Based on data from the World Health Organization 2010 (WHO), poor women's reproductive health problems have reached 33% of the total burden of disease suffered by women in the world, one of which is vaginal discharge. The number of women in the world who have experienced vaginal discharge is 75%, while European women who experience vaginal discharge are 25%. This figure is greater than reproductive problems in men which only reached 12.3% at the same age as women. These data show that vaginal discharge in women in the world, Europe, and in Indonesia is quite high. The method used is Pre Test and Post Test using a questionnaire. Based on the results of the counseling there was an increase in respondents' knowledge of reproductive health which was in the good category as many as 33 (70.2%). In conclusion, there is a significant increase in respondents' knowledge after being given counseling.
